Default Teams

PORT ADELAIDE
B: Thurstans, Wakelin, Pettigrew
HB: Surjan, C.Cornes, Thomas
C: Cassisi, S.Burgoyne, Lonie
HF: P.Burgoyne, White, Rodan
F: Ebert, Tredrea, Lade
FOLL: Brogan, K.Cornes, Pearce
I/C: Krakouer, Motlop, Bentley, Mahoney
EM: Westhoff, Boak, Symes
IN: Brogan
OUT: Chaplin

RICHMOND
B: Newman, McGuane, J.Bowden
HB: Raines, Polak, Oakley-Nicholls
C: Tivendale, Deledio, Tuck
HF: Pettifer, Richardson, King
F: Krakouer, Schulz, Hughes
FOLL: Pattison, Johnson, Foley
I/C: White, Hyde, Howat, Polo
IN: Krakouer, Tivendale, Howat, Polo, Pattison
OUT: Tambling (shoulder), Simmonds (ankle), Meyer, Jackson, Moore
